762 IC Interface
5.2.1
762 IC Interface features
The Metrohm 762 IC Interface is available as a one system ver-
sion (2.762.0010) or a two system version (2.762.0020). Each sys-
tem can control a complete ion chromatography or HPLC equip-
ment and contains the following parts:
x Two 24-bit Analog-to-Digital Converters (often abbreviated
as ADC) to acquire two analog signals from two different de-
tectors simultaneously (for example conductivity detection and
UV detection).
x One external start input.
x One start button at the interface front panel.
x RS232 communication ports to control up to eight devices
of a complete ion chromatography equipment.
x Seven Event output lines.
The 762 IC Interface is normally connected to a PC COM port us-
ing the 6.2134.100 connecting cable.
For detailed information about the 762 IC Interface see 762 In-
structions for Use.
5.2.2
762 icon on the toolbar
The
762 icon
is available on the toolbar if a 762 IC Interface has
been installed with the new system wizard or by using the
device>
option of the
WORKPLACE
window (see section 5.1.2). By
clicking this icon the
762 IC Interface
window for parameter set-
tings opens.
